
Nigerian street-hop star Habeeb Okikiola Badmus, popularly known as Portable, was honored with an award from the Mayor of Brampton during his visit to the Canadian government house on Tuesday. The singer took to Instagram to express his excitement, sharing photos and videos from the event, where he was accompanied by his team.
In his heartfelt message, Portable expressed gratitude, stating, “Finally, Portable Omolalomi ZAZUU in Canada. I just want to say thank you to the Canadian government and the City of Brampton for the Corporation of the City of Brampton award.”
The award recognizes Portable’s contributions to music and culture, marking a significant moment in his career.
In related news, Portable recently announced that he has secured a 10-year work visa for Canada. In a video shared on Instagram in August, he exclaimed, “Alhamdulilahi CEO DR ZEHNATION Going to Canada. Going and coming 10 years working permit,” showcasing his enthusiasm for this new chapter in his professional journey.
